What is a motel?
At most motels, you’ll often find an outdoor pool and free parking. When you stay at a motel, you’ll usually access your room directly from the parking lot. The word “motel” was invented in 1925 by the owner of the Milestone Mo-Tel in San Luis Obispo, California.
What can I do in Diamond Point?
Those who’ve visited Diamond Point like the lakeside. As you’re sightseeing around the area, be sure to enjoy all there is to see and do. Some outdoorsy places nearby include Lake George, Hearthstone Point Campground, and Shepard’s Beach Park. You’ll find these family-friendly sights in the area: Dr. Morbid’s Haunted House, Six Flags Great Escape, and House of Frankenstein Wax Museum. While you’re checking out the area, consider visiting Adirondack Winery, Lake George Shoreline Cruises, and Lake George Steamboat Company.
What's the weather like in Diamond Point?
Weather can make or break a roadtrip, so here’s some data about year-round temperatures in Diamond Point to help you plan yours: The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 66°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 26°F. The snowiest months in Diamond Point are January, March, April, and November, with each month seeing an average of 14 inches of snowfall.
